Match the device to the codec, wire the main screen

Which device should carry the stream to the TV?

Almost any current streaming device works, and the differences that matter are hardware decoding, memory and remote quality. Firestick, Roku, Apple TV, Android TV boxes and MAG units all handle mainstream players. What separates them in daily use is whether the chip decodes HEVC in hardware, since software decoding on an older stick produces stutter that looks exactly like a network fault, and how much memory the device has for a large channel list. A smart TV's built-in app is convenient but usually the weakest option, because television processors age faster than the panel does. If a five-year-old set is your only screen, a small external box is the cheaper fix.

Wired or Wi-Fi for the main television?

Wire the main screen if you can. A live feed carries almost no stored video, so a two-second Wi-Fi dropout becomes a visible freeze, while the same interruption on an on-demand title is quietly absorbed. Ethernet removes the most common source of short drops and costs nothing beyond a cable. Where wiring is impossible, use the 5 GHz band, keep the device within sight of the router, and avoid passing through a mesh hop if the router is in range. Powerline adapters are a reasonable middle path. None of this raises the bitrate available to you; it stabilizes what you already have, which is the actual problem in most homes.

The picture stutters. Is it the TV or the stream?

Scope it before you change anything. One channel stuttering while its neighbors are clean means that source. A whole group failing while other groups play is server-side and no TV setting will help. Everything failing together points at the line, the player or the session. Then switch away to another channel and switch back: if the picture returns cleanly, the session stalled and bandwidth was never the cause. If stutter appears only on 4K channels while 1080p is fine, suspect software decoding on the device rather than the network, since that pattern follows the codec rather than the bitrate you are paying for.

Several television player apps are keyed to a device identifier generated on the set itself, separate from any subscription login. Replace the television and that key goes with it, so the app license has to be repurchased or transferred.

A favorites or watchlist built inside one player app lives in that app's own local data and does not carry over if a different player app is used to access the same playlist, since favorites are an app-side feature layered on top of the playlist, not part of the playlist data itself.

What internet speed do I need to stream IPTV to my TV?
Around 5-8 Mbps held steadily for 1080p and 15-25 Mbps for 4K, per stream. If two or three screens play at once, add those figures together rather than assuming your headline speed covers it. Consistency matters far more than the peak number on your bill, since a line that averages hundreds of megabits but drops for four seconds will still freeze a live channel. That is why an Ethernet cable to the main television is usually a bigger improvement than a faster plan.
Why does 4K stutter while 1080p plays perfectly?
That pattern usually points at decoding rather than bandwidth. HEVC needs hardware support, and a device that falls back to software decoding will stutter on 4K while handling 1080p comfortably, because the load scales with resolution. Check whether your device lists hardware HEVC support. If it does not, a current streaming box resolves it. Only if 1080p also breaks in the same session is it worth looking at the connection, and even then the switch-away-and-back test should come first.

Does hiding channels really make the TV app faster?
Yes, and it is the single most effective setup step people skip. Player apps keep the whole visible channel list in memory, and they become unstable above roughly 18,000 entries, so loading a catalog of 54,000+ channels in full can make a perfectly good box feel broken. Hide the countries and categories you will never open, keep a few thousand visible, and the guide stays quick. You can add a group back at any time without changing anything on the account.
